Season 7, Episode 5
Original Air Date: 19 October 1984
Directed by: Ralph Riskin
Written by: Martin Roth
Created by: Gy Waldron
Plot Summary

Boss is up to his old schemes again, this time setting up Daisy as the winner of a phony contest for being the one millionth customer of the Capitol City Department Store. The prizes given to Daisy are "hot", as in stolen, and Boss' aim is to frame the Dukes for the thefts. It all goes awry, however, when Boss bumps his head, develops amnesia, and forgets about the scam. His partners in crime kidnap him, fearing he'll spill the scam to the authorities.

Trivia
- Audrey Landers (Billie Jean) previously appeared as Gail Flatt in R.I.P. Henry Flatt. At the same time, she was also playing Afton Cooper in Dallas.
- John Matuszak (Stoney) was an American football player before he turned to acting. He's probably best known for playing Sloth in The Goonies (1985).
